summ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Dror Levin <spatz@gentoo.org>2010-05-22 22:57:01 +0000
committerDror Levin <spatz@gentoo.org>2010-05-22 22:57:01 +0000
commit713dc2ff09a534681305de1ea34a635f2e5648f6 (patch)
tree0caaab2fb82c2911b526e61238e6622886bcac14 /net-irc
parentAdd REE18 support (diff)
downloadhistorical-713dc2ff09a534681305de1ea34a635f2e5648f6.tar.gz
historical-713dc2ff09a534681305de1ea34a635f2e5648f6.tar.bz2
historical-713dc2ff09a534681305de1ea34a635f2e5648f6.zip
Version bump. Apply patch for last minute bug causing the tab close button preference to not be respected.
Package-Manager: portage-2.2_rc67/cvs/Linux x86_64
Diffstat (limited to 'net-irc')
-rw-r--r--net-irc/konversation/ChangeLog9
-rw-r--r--net-irc/konversation/Manifest19
-rw-r--r--net-irc/konversation/files/konversation-1.3_beta1-respect-close-button-tabs.patch25
-rw-r--r--net-irc/konversation/konversation-1.3_beta1.ebuild39
4 files changed, 90 insertions, 2 deletions
diff --git a/net-irc/konversation/ChangeLog b/net-irc/konversation/ChangeLog
index 1e3b03190ede..45dfe5fc0bbb 100644
--- a/net-irc/konversation/ChangeLog
+++ b/net-irc/konversation/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for net-irc/konversation
#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-irc/konversation/ChangeLog,v 1.93 2010/02/12 08:59:18 ssuominen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-irc/konversation/ChangeLog,v 1.94 2010/05/22 22:57:00 spatz Exp $
+
+*konversation-1.3_beta1 (22 May 2010)
+
+ 22 May 2010; Dror Levin <spatz@gentoo.org> +konversation-1.3_beta1.ebuild,
+ +files/konversation-1.3_beta1-respect-close-button-tabs.patch:
+ Version bump. Apply patch for last minute bug causing the tab close button
+ preference to not be respected.
*konversation-1.2.3 (12 Feb 2010)
diff --git a/net-irc/konversation/Manifest b/net-irc/konversation/Manifest
index 5bce8335d802..7ddb59e5dcfc 100644
--- a/net-irc/konversation/Manifest
+++ b/net-irc/konversation/Manifest
@@ -1,6 +1,23 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A512
+
+AUX konversation-1.3_beta1-respect-close-button-tabs.patch 861 RMD160 e3db90f017d3f324caaba39e3c127ea5235cffb4 SHA1 51d9c541c7b314b33036c2f9bdf8a034c0bd2585 SHA256 c11511ba43d55dc7541cd57f35b5627d9659b7344c3c2c9ddfcb7e98b8905c57
DIST konversation-1.2.3.tar.bz2 2997272 RMD160 87d03ec13d90f74d991ff139f9f2e7125c5dd0ef SHA1 792fa864fe3e0de0c0cb994ce97f68345f57d09f SHA256 afca39a2f6a1e5324a1e05390efc694f2aecfe4836f9131110ebac479991001a
DIST konversation-1.2.tar.bz2 2869819 RMD160 23ec1abb185b2d1a69b003996f35cd33febaf384 SHA1 64376d427b628ccde56598cfc9be3d8f31d757fc SHA256 652425a4a1a7a9a5b563912ffcfca3447210d8c3fa7b8894289069548f87f49a
+DIST konversation-1.3-beta1.tar.bz2 3264850 RMD160 932be18fcc14fa7ea36d1d86f36c9c20e90681e6 SHA1 bde2b4cce7900fab1f69d1d50cfda0bc935d1b29 SHA256 53e4b93f86a34947302520ff828d4f7ad0de98021fd5292b740e0f682e2e8539
EBUILD konversation-1.2.3.ebuild 903 RMD160 2168073eadeb5133cad015e43baeb6acbd390b93 SHA1 a766f498707e71254630c162613d390b1141e7b0 SHA256 65a337568772b015d16efc636c9cc60bcb9b9e0ddebc4d8fae9f56b76bbeee86
EBUILD konversation-1.2.ebuild 879 RMD160 1830175e80eebe1edb5066449cad4ad23491e3cf SHA1 edcac94fbcfc900424c2f30fe873830ff1eff7ea SHA256 3f40b8c9ff645368fb33813fb9520c615b20d8cb2fb6ddeeb6dd5971be4a132d
-MISC ChangeLog 13629 RMD160 aadd85516c3f8e777d9f2897e915db83f7410ed3 SHA1 8712ad9e30536439362eb585114f1cc4affb26d6 SHA256 ceeebf33fc5b512096a32a2238e76bf1bde6dd1f34f96ef387b48c5151a2b27d
+EBUILD konversation-1.3_beta1.ebuild 1042 RMD160 9805a928b31f39dc1d73138a912585b0b5dfc523 SHA1 d01423eee28aa25605c25e08e1084f1371a34658 SHA256 d2f1f8de09dc1e04695b0e860cac2e1b7581bfd652da607bba07e8887ca28ceb
+MISC ChangeLog 13918 RMD160 49fa63f815d73154583db4ab5b18445d0f76f7f0 SHA1 307842a938a78df3c326555cbe09ef88cc57ddbd SHA256 05832dfaba62fe058afd2c9d30d7b1de735dc8fea7480d990f344a11dfecc95a
MISC metadata.xml 177 RMD160 8850c5b17b8777a62f670a0ade3bab8144c2b2dc SHA1 500abb13eb9ab623336557bb1246056b39896046 SHA256 0d969af6afa28170dac4b321dd8489b27d322f49f40c39aa3f614953f85292ce
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.15 (GNU/Linux)
+
+iQEcBAEBCgAGBQJL+GFNAAoJEAWF714uGAc66A0H/AoaW7Ah74CtyCO5Ugs/pA0I
+riZ+ZiwcXKZ28AS/tL+aaG7iDvUHakzfx9n7Po4SbebM9wV6K4idAFUNmeQLUiPr
+uL1K8Cc0ZhgYw9nJQlWPNRzQivJnvNnINsJ+X91oSdltWx0UKvPOK3YnY0Qke2IG
+cvBigFhGd8cNHHiW6kwVzmw9uYVFPUtkAy2IM638JM+XCgt3GIU2hHDRT38Hbxqi
+D80WliaugIznj6u+qoHRsjMoTLxwhfSclsa0/+MZimHrKFACGVjBddkRHL8Gdb4R
+LkM1EMjxq5KkN+L5dg8QW5LpKLnGqdXTnjPs6YLYf83IBpr5XAoNJoMfcUFClDw=
+=EBbv
+-----END PGP SIGNATURE-----
diff --git a/net-irc/konversation/files/konversation-1.3_beta1-respect-close-button-tabs.patch b/net-irc/konversation/files/konversation-1.3_beta1-respect-close-button-tabs.patch
new file mode 100644
index 000000000000..a6efc912a7fe
--- /dev/null
+++ b/net-irc/konversation/files/konversation-1.3_beta1-respect-close-button-tabs.patch
@@ -0,0 +1,25 @@
+From aa233e3b66b675c62a03f1bce793e67b87b732b9 Mon Sep 17 00:00:00 2001
+From: Eike Hein <hein@kde.org>
+Date: Sat, 22 May 2010 22:01:51 +0200
+Subject: [PATCH] Fix close buttons on tabs preference not being respected for top/bottom tabs.
+
+---
+ src/viewer/viewcontainer.cpp | 2 +-
+ 1 files changed, 1 insertions(+), 1 deletions(-)
+
+diff --git a/src/viewer/viewcontainer.cpp b/src/viewer/viewcontainer.cpp
+index 6207f66..d7b30e6 100644
+--- a/src/viewer/viewcontainer.cpp
++++ b/src/viewer/viewcontainer.cpp
+@@ -409,7 +409,7 @@ void ViewContainer::updateTabWidgetAppearance()
+ else
+ m_tabWidget->cornerWidget()->hide();
+
+- m_tabWidget->tabBar()->setTabsClosable(true);
++ m_tabWidget->tabBar()->setTabsClosable(Preferences::self()->closeButtons());
+
+ m_tabWidget->setAutomaticResizeTabs(Preferences::self()->useMaxSizedTabs());
+ }
+--
+1.6.1
+
diff --git a/net-irc/konversation/konversation-1.3_beta1.ebuild b/net-irc/konversation/konversation-1.3_beta1.ebuild
new file mode 100644
index 000000000000..3e563a7a3fa2
--- /dev/null
+++ b/net-irc/konversation/konversation-1.3_beta1.ebuild
@@ -0,0 +1,39 @@
+# Copyright 1999-2010 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/net-irc/konversation/konversation-1.3_beta1.ebuild,v 1.1 2010/05/22 22:57:00 spatz Exp $
+
+EAPI=2
+KDE_LINGUAS="bg ca cs da de el en_GB es et fi fr gl hu it ja nb nds nl pa pl pt
+pt_BR ru sk sr sv tr uk zh_CN zh_TW"
+KDE_DOC_DIRS="doc doc-translations/%lingua_${PN}"
+inherit kde4-base
+
+MY_PV="${PV/_/-}"
+MY_P="${PN}-${MY_PV}"
+DESCRIPTION="A user friendly IRC Client for KDE4"
+HOMEPAGE="http://konversation.kde.org"
+SRC_URI="mirror://kde/unstable/${PN}/${MY_PV}/src/${MY_P}.tar.bz2"
+
+LICENSE="GPL-2 FDL-1.2"
+SLOT="4"
+KEYWORDS="~amd64 ~x86"
+IUSE="+crypt debug +handbook"
+
+DEPEND="x11-libs/libXScrnSaver
+ >=kde-base/kdepimlibs-${KDE_MINIMAL}
+ crypt? ( app-crypt/qca:2 )"
+
+DOCS="AUTHORS ChangeLog NEWS README TODO"
+PATCHES=(
+ "${FILESDIR}/${P}-respect-close-button-tabs.patch"
+)
+
+S="${WORKDIR}/${MY_P}"
+
+src_configure() {
+ mycmakeargs+=(
+ $(cmake-utils_use_with crypt QCA2)
+ )
+
+ kde4-base_src_configure
+}